Diese Demo basiert auf Spring Boot und implementiert die Back-End-Entwicklungsfunktion des öffentlichen WeChat-Kontos.
Bei diesem Projekt handelt es sich um ein Demo-Demonstrationsprogramm von WxJava. Weitere Demos finden Sie hier.
Wenn Sie Fragen haben, wenden Sie sich bitte an [hier stellen]. Vielen Dank für Ihre Mitarbeit.
Nutzungsschritte:
- Bitte beachten Sie, dass diese Demo beim Kompilieren Lombok-Unterstützung hinzufügt, um den Code zu vereinfachen. Wenn Sie Lombok nicht kennen, können Sie sich beispielsweise zuerst die entsprechenden Kenntnisse aneignen.
- Wenn Anfänger auf Probleme stoßen, lesen Sie außerdem bitte zuerst den FAQ-Bereich auf der [Homepage der Entwicklungsdokumentation], um viele Umwege zu vermeiden und viel Zeit zu sparen.
- Konfiguration: Kopieren Sie
/src/main/resources/application.yml.template
oder ändern Sie seine Erweiterung, um die Datei application.yml
zu generieren. Füllen Sie die entsprechende Konfiguration entsprechend Ihren Anforderungen aus (Hinweis: Der Text nach dem Doppelpunkt in der yml-Datei muss hinzugefügt werden vor Space hinzugefügt werden, können Sie auf die vorhandene Konfiguration verweisen, andernfalls ist die Attributeinstellung nicht erfolgreich. - Die wichtigsten Konfigurationsanweisungen lauten wie folgt:
wx:
mp:
useRedis: false
redisConfig:
host: 127.0.0.1
port: 6379
timeout: 2000
configs:
- appId: 1111 # 第一个公众号的appid
secret: 1111 # 公众号的appsecret
token: 111 # 接口配置里的Token值
aesKey: 111 # 接口配置里的EncodingAESKey值
- appId: 2222 # 第二个公众号的appid,以下同上
secret: 1111
token: 111
aesKey: 111
- Führen Sie das Java-Programm aus:
WxMpDemoApplication
; - Konfigurieren Sie die Schnittstellenadresse im offiziellen WeChat-Konto: http://im öffentlichen Netzwerk zugänglicher Domänenname/wx/portal/xxxxx (beachten Sie, dass xxxxx der App-ID-Wert des entsprechenden offiziellen Kontos ist);
- Ändern Sie die Implementierung jedes Handlers entsprechend Ihren eigenen Anforderungen und fügen Sie Ihre eigene Geschäftslogik hinzu.